Record and development:
On-line poker emerged within the late 1990s due to developments in technology while the internet. The first online poker room, globe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a small but enthusiastic neighborhood. But was at the early 2000s that internet poker experienced exponential growth, mainly due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Popularity and Accessibility:
One of the most significant cause of the immense rise in popularity of on-line poker is its accessibility. People can log on to their most favorite online poker systems anytime, from anywhere, using their computers or mobile phones. This convenience has actually drawn a diverse player base, which range from leisure players to professionals, causing the fast expansion of internet poker.

Advantages of Internet Poker:
Online poker provides several benefits over conventional br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ises. Firstly, it includes a broader array of game options, including various poker variants and stakes, providing toward tastes and spending plans of most forms of players. Furthermore, on-line poker spaces tend to be open 24/7, eliminating the limitations of physical casino running hours. Additionally, web systems frequently offer appealing bonuses, commitment programs, therefore the ability to play numerous tables simultaneously, improving the overall gaming knowledge.
